The Barriere Secondary Senior Girls Basketball Team finished sixth the weekend of Mar. 8 - 12, at the A Senior Girls Basketball Provincials hosted in Duncan, B.C.

In their first round match up the girls defeated Bulkley Valley Christian School 53-48.  The team was led by Tyra Noble who scored 18 points and Hannah Feller who added 14 points.

In their second game of the tournament the girls faced a competitive squad from Mulgraves Secondary, and unfortunately were defeated 50-28.  In this game Hannah Feller led the way with 14 points.

The girls bounced back in their third game of the tournament and defeated Cedar Christian School from Prince George 66-30.   Again Tyra Noble led Barriere with 17 points, Hannah Feller chipped in 16 points and Vanessa Balatti added another 10.

In their final game of the season, the girls lost a hard fought battle to Keremeos in a fight for fifth and sixth place.  The girls were defeated in the final minutes of the game 50-49.

This was a rematch of the Okanagan Final and the girls worked incredibly hard in this game.  Breann Fischer led the way with her tenacious defence and competitive spirit.

Congratulations to Breann Fischer, Tyra Noble, Vanessa Balatti and Hannah Feller for being honoured with Player of the Game Awards throughout the tournament.
